Unveiling the Hidden Drawbacks of PVC Wall Cladding


PVC wall cladding has gained popularity in the construction industry due to its affordability, durability, and ease of installation. However, it is essential to consider the potential disadvantages associated with this material. In this blog post, we will delve into the drawbacks of PVC wall cladding, shedding light on its limitations and providing valuable insights for informed decision-making.

  1. Limited Heat Resistance:
    One significant disadvantage of PVC wall cladding is its limited heat resistance. PVC panels can deform or melt when exposed to high temperatures, making them unsuitable for areas prone to extreme heat, such as near fireplaces or stoves. It is crucial to consider alternative materials for such applications to ensure safety and longevity.
  2. Environmental Concerns:
    While PVC wall cladding offers a cost-effective solution, it is essential to address the environmental concerns associated with its production and disposal. PVC is derived from non-renewable fossil fuels and requires a significant amount of energy during manufacturing. Additionally, the disposal of PVC panels can contribute to environmental pollution, as they do not readily decompose. Considering eco-friendly alternatives like natural wood or sustainable materials can help mitigate these concerns.
  3. Limited Aesthetic Options:
    Another drawback of PVC wall cladding is the limited range of aesthetic options available. While PVC panels come in various colors and patterns, they may not offer the same level of customization as other materials like natural stone or ceramic tiles. This limitation can restrict design possibilities, especially for those seeking a unique and personalized interior or exterior finish.
  4. Vulnerability to Impact Damage:
    PVC wall cladding, although durable, is susceptible to impact damage. Heavy objects or accidental impacts can cause cracks or dents in the panels, compromising their appearance and structural integrity. This vulnerability makes PVC less suitable for high-traffic areas or places where accidental collisions are more likely to occur.
  5. Maintenance Challenges:
    Maintaining PVC wall cladding requires careful attention to prevent staining and discoloration. Harsh cleaning agents or abrasive materials can damage the surface, leading to a dull or faded appearance. Additionally, PVC panels may accumulate dust or grime over time, requiring regular cleaning to maintain their aesthetic appeal. Considering low-maintenance alternatives like ceramic tiles or stainless steel can alleviate these maintenance challenges.
